excel表格走势图怎么制作软件(Excel图表制作)


Excel表格走势图制作软件是数据可视化领域的重要工具,其核心价值在于将结构化数据转化为直观的图形表达。这类软件需兼顾数据准确性、图表多样性、交互灵活性及跨平台适配性等维度,同时需处理海量数据运算、动态更新、多格式兼容等技术难点。从功能架构来看,软件需整合数据预处理、图表引擎、交互控件、导出模块等核心组件,并通过模块化设计实现功能扩展。在技术实现层面,需平衡Excel原生功能与自定义开发的关系,既要利用Excel的公式计算和透视表优势,又要通过插件或API增强可视化能力。实际开发中需重点关注数据绑定机制、渲染性能优化、跨设备显示一致性等关键问题,同时需设计友好的用户界面以降低操作门槛。
一、数据预处理与清洗模块
数据准备阶段直接影响走势图的准确性,软件需提供智能数据清洗功能。支持空值处理(删除/填充)、异常值检测(标准差法、箱线图法)、数据类型转换(文本转数值)等基础操作,同时需集成重复值去重、数据分组(按时间/类别/区间)等高级功能。
典型处理流程:
- 通过正则表达式识别非标准日期格式
- 建立数据校验规则库(如数值范围、格式规范)
- 支持自定义清洗脚本(Python/JavaScript)
二、图表类型智能匹配系统
软件需内置智能推荐算法,根据数据特征自动匹配最优图表类型。建立数据特征矩阵(数据量/维度/分布)与图表类型库的映射关系,例如:
数据特征 | 推荐图表 |
---|---|
时间序列+单指标 | 折线图/面积图 |
多类别对比 | 柱状图/雷达图 |
占比关系 | 饼图/环形图 |
地理分布 | 热力图/矢量地图 |
同时提供手动切换图表类型的自由度,支持组合图表(主次坐标轴)和多层嵌套图表。
三、动态交互功能设计
现代走势图软件需具备以下交互特性:
- 数据钻取:点击图元显示明细数据
- 联动过滤:多图表间条件同步
- 动画过渡:数据变化时的平滑演示
- tooltip定制:悬停显示多维数据
技术实现需采用D3.js等矢量绘图库,结合事件委托机制处理高频率交互。示例:折线图节点点击触发数据表格定位,柱状图筛选触发其他图表动态更新。
四、性能优化策略
针对大数据量场景(百万级数据点),需实施多重优化:
优化方向 | 具体措施 |
---|---|
数据采样 | 基于密度的聚类抽样算法 |
图形渲染 | Canvas+WebGL混合渲染 |
内存管理 | 对象池复用技术 |
异步处理 | WebWorker数据预处理 |
实测显示,采用SVG渐进加载技术可使千条折线图初始加载时间缩短60%。
五、跨平台兼容性方案
软件需同时支持:
- 桌面端:Windows/Mac/Linux原生应用
- 浏览器:Chrome/Firefox/Safari内核适配
- 移动端:响应式布局+手势操作
采用Electron框架可实现多平台统一体验,但需注意:
平台特性 | 适配要点 |
---|---|
Windows | DirectX加速渲染 |
macOS | Retina显示优化 |
移动端 | 触控事件防抖处理 |
六、多格式导出与协作
输出模块需支持:
- 图像格式:SVG/PNG/PDF(分层导出)
- 交互文档:HTML+JavaScript包
- 办公集成:PPT/Word内嵌对象
协作功能需实现:
- 实时共享编辑(WebSocket同步)
- 版本历史回溯(快照存储)
- 权限控制(查看/编辑/评论分离)
七、安全与权限管理体系
企业级应用需构建三级防护:
防护层级 | 技术手段 |
---|---|
传输安全 | HTTPS+数据加密 |
存储安全 | AES-256加密存储 |
访问控制 | RBAC权限模型 |
特殊场景处理:敏感数据脱敏显示(如手机号掩码)、水印生成(动态生成用户ID+时间戳)。
八、AI增强分析功能
集成机器学习模块实现智能分析:
- 趋势预测:LSTM神经网络建模
- 异常检测:孤立森林算法
- 模式识别:聚类分析(K-Means)
典型应用场景:销售数据自动拟合增长曲线,设备传感器数据实时异常报警。需提供算法参数可视化调节界面,降低使用门槛。
在数字化转型加速的当下,Excel表格走势图制作软件已突破传统作图工具范畴,演变为集数据处理、可视化分析、智能决策于一体的综合性平台。其发展脉络清晰展现了技术进步对生产力工具的重塑过程:从早期静态图表生成到动态交互呈现,从单一文件操作到云端协同,从人工经验判断到AI辅助决策。未来软件演进将聚焦三个维度:一是深化与云计算、物联网的数据对接能力,实现实时数据流可视化;二是提升AR/VR等沉浸式展示方式的应用深度;三是构建更完善的自动化分析体系,通过预训练模型库降低用户技术门槛。值得关注的是,随着边缘计算设备的普及,离线环境下的高性能渲染能力将成为新的技术竞争点。此类软件的持续创新不仅推动着数据可视化技术的发展边界,更在重塑企业决策流程和公众认知方式,其社会价值已远超工具属性本身。





